A fast, grim gauntlet of physical trials with constant looming death, told in plain, urgent prose aimed at younger readers who want visceral stakes without complex prose demands. Best for: YA horror-adventure fans who want a fast, trial-by-trial survival structure with genuine danger to the hero..
It ends on a cliffhanger — plan on reading the next book.
Genuinely frightening — the genome rates its fear intensity high.
It's young adult — teen protagonists with crossover appeal.
